Beethoven’s Ninth Symphony Op. 125 incorporates part of the poem An die Freude (“To Joyâ€), a hymn written by Friedrich Schiller, with the text sung by soloists and a choir in its last movement. It was the first example of a major composer using the human voice as prominently as instruments in a symphony, creating a far-reaching work that set the tone for the symphonic form adopted by Romantic composers. This is Ludwig van Beethoven’s last complete symphony. The choral symphony, better known as the Ninth Symphony or The Ninth, is one of the best-known works in the Western repertoire, considered an icon and predecessor of Romantic music and one of Beethoven’s great masterpieces. It was first performed on May 7, 1824 at the Kärntnertortheater in Vienna, Austria.

The Turkish March is the 4th movement of operatic work by Beethoven, The Ruins of Athens. Originally written in 1809 as Theme with Six Variations for Piano, Op. 76, it was later used to accompany August von Kotzebue’s play for the dedication of a new theater in Pest. In Latin America, this movement became known as “The Elephant Never Forgets†in Jean-Jacques Perrey’s version and was used as the opening theme for the Mexican TV comedy El Chavo del Ocho. Published by RayThompsonMusic (A0.1095028). Translated as (Duet with Two Obligato Eyeglasses) or k/a The Obligato/Eyeglass Duo. Originally written for viola and cello, here it is arranged for a viola duet. I have ONLY arranged the minuetto and trio This duet for viola and cello from 1796-1797 is believed to have been written for Beethoven's longtime frind, Baron Nikolaus Zmeskall. The Baron was an accomplished cellist, and Beethoven had played the viola back in Bonn. Both men wore spectacles at times, which is believed to be the genesis of the curious name. Apparently Beethoven wrote Zmeskall a letter containing these lines: Dearest Baron Garbage-truck driver, I am obliged to you for the weakness of your eyes. Perhaps Zmeskall lent Beethven his eyeglasses. Who knows? One thing is certain: the piece exudes a sense of sheer playfulness, similar in spirit (if not style) to Mozart's Duo for Violin and Viola in B-Flat.

Duration: 2:50 minutes.Contents: Scherzo: AllegroBeethoven's Bagatelles Op. 33 are quite typical of his early style, retaining many compositional features of the early Classical period.  While they may seem light-hearted and not to be taken too seriously, they are still well-crafted works that embody the younger Beethoven's style. The Bagatelles Op. 33 were composed by Beethoven in 1801-02 and published in 1803. Bagatelles are shorter and less complex than sonatas, often consisting of a single movement. They were intended to be played as light entertainment or as encores at the end of a concert.

An arrangement for double wind quintet.(and bass)This is the third movement of the symphony.It is a scherzo in F major and a trio in D major. In Beethoven's original orchestral composition the trio (based on an Austrian pilgrims' hymn is played twice rather than once.This expansion of the usual A–B–A structure of ternary form into A–B–A–B–A was quite common in other works of Beethoven of this period.The movement is written lasts almost 10 minutes, making it a bit of a blow for the wind playersI have included an optional cut.This becomes as A-B-A movement, followed by the 4 bar coda, and final presto.The horn parts are mainly Beethoven's, with some additions of mine...the parts are for Horns in D, (Horns in F are included)The clarinet parts are for clts in A ( as the original), I also include clarinet in Bb parts.

Beethoven’s Eleven Bagatelles Op. 119 are known for their expressive melodies and harmonies, and their innovative approach to form and tonality. The bagatelles were written during a period of time when Beethoven was undergoing a difficult phase in his life; he was struggling with hearing loss, family problems, and depression. Despite these challenges, he managed to produce a set of musical gems that are deeply moving and uplifting. The bagatelles show a remarkable range and depth of emotion, from playful and humorous to introspective and melancholic. These pieces serve as a testament to his resilience and creative genius in the face of personal adversity. More than two centuries after their composition, the bagatelles continue to inspire music enthusiasts around the world. The Bagatelles Op. 119 is a combination of old and new pieces that were not originally planned as a cycle. No. 1. Allegretto.No. 2. Andante con moto.No. 3. à l’ Allemande.No. 4. Andante cantabile.No. 5. Risoluto.No. 6. Andante – Allegretto.No. 7. Tranquillo.No. 8. Moderato cantabile.No. 9. Vivace moderato.No. 10. Allegramente.No. 11. Andante ma non troppo.

Beethoven's Octet, Opus 103, is an early work in four movements originally scored for pairs of oboes, clarinets, bassoons and horns - a typical wind ensemble of the day. Some time later, Beethoven reworked much of the musical material and used it as the basis for his String Quintet, Opus 04. The first movement of the Octet, arranged here for a standard woodwind quintet, is lively and cheerful and the contrasting colour of each instrument gives definition to the musical phrases.
